October 31, 2008

Follow-up: Agriprocessors Exec Arrested Over Illegal Hiring

"Federal agents Thursday arrested a former senior executive of a large kosher meatpacking plant on charges that he employed illegal immigrants for commercial gain and helped them secure fake documents, a sign of stepped up enforcement against employers who use illegal labor. Agents for Immigration and Customs Enforcement arrested Sholom Rubashkin, who headed the Agriprocessors Inc. plant in Postville, Iowa, on various criminal immigration and fraudulent-identity charges outlined in a complaint filed in U.S. District Court in Cedar Rapids," the Wall Street Journal reported.

October 31, 2008

Hazleton Lawyers Make Their Case in Appeals Hearing

"Attorneys argued whether a Hazleton law would create a patchwork of immigration policies or supplement federal policy in a way allowed by Congress during an extended hearing on Thursday before the U.S. Third Circuit Court of Appeals. The three-judge panel normally limits arguments to 15 minutes, but allowed the hearing to proceed for two hours," the Scranton Times writes. "Whether Congress carved out the exclusive right to regulate immigration and pre-empted states and cities from any role was a major argument. The parties also discussed whether the Hazleton ordinance provides due process for challenging how it is enforced. And they argued whether the people in the case, including four plaintiffs allowed to remain unnamed because they didn’t know if they had the proper immigration status, had standing to sue the city."

October 30, 2008

Agriprocessors Fined $10 Million Over Labor Violations

"A kosher meatpacking plant that was the site of one of the nation's largest immigration raids was fined nearly $10 million by the state Wednesday over accusations that it violated state labor laws. Iowa Labor Commissioner Dave Neil assessed the civil penalties against Agriprocessors in Postville for what he called repeated violations of Iowa's wage laws from January 2006 to June 2008," the AP reports. "Iowa Workforce Development, the state's labor agency, spent months before and after the May 12 raid examining internal company documents, said agency spokeswoman Kerry Koonce. Documents included time sheets, payroll and wage stubs, she said."

October 28, 2008

Houston Sheriffs Test New Fingerprint Check

"The Harris County Sheriff's Office is leading a test of an automated fingerprint check system that allows jailers to simultaneously review suspects' immigration and criminal histories, thereby helping to identify and remove non-U.S. citizens convicted of crimes. The new program links the FBI's database with the Department of Homeland Security's database, known as IDENT (the Automated Biometric Identification System), officials said Monday. All inmates will be run against the database," the Houston Chronicle reports. "The Sheriff's Office was selected to lead the pilot program in part because Houston has 'one of the largest criminal alien populations in the United States,' said Immigration and Customs Enforcement spokesman Gregory Palmore, the Houston Chronicle reported in its online edition Monday."

October 28, 2008

Gates Defends LA Special Order 40, Despite Murders

"Tanned, toned and looking as if he's aged little in the 16 years since he left office, former LAPD Chief Daryl F. Gates returned to City Hall on Monday to wade into a contentious debate over police enforcement and illegal immigrants. Gates helped craft Special Order 40, the 1979 measure that limits when officers can inquire about the immigration status of crime victims and suspects," the LA Times reports. "Special Order 40 became the subject of intense debate earlier this year after the slaying of high school football player Jamiel Shaw II. Shaw was allegedly gunned down by a reputed gang member who was in the country illegally. Pedro Espinoza, who awaits trial on a murder charge, was released from Los Angeles County Jail the day before the killing."

October 27, 2008

Hazleton Case Hearing This Week

"A federal appeal for a 2006 case that put Hazleton Mayor Lou Barletta in the spotlight will be held five days before he faces U.S. Rep. Paul Kanjorski in their race for Congress. Two years ago, Barletta gained national attention by supporting Hazleton’s Illegal Immigration Relief Act. The law never took effect, and a federal judge in Scranton overturned it last summer. The U.S. Circuit Court in Philadelphia plans to hear an appeal in the case at 1:30 p.m. Thursday," the Standard Speaker writes. "During the appeal, three judges selected by computer will listen to arguments and ask questions of attorneys representing the city and the law’s opponents, led by the American Civil Liberties Union. Each side will have 30 minutes to present a case, and the judges aren’t expected to decide the appeal for months. Still, the hearing might revive an issue that initially attracted voters to Barletta."

October 24, 2008

Court Rules Challenge to SF Sanctuary Policy can Proceed

"A state appeals court reinstated a taxpayer lawsuit on Wednesday that accuses San Francisco officials of violating a state law that requires police who make drug arrests to notify federal authorities if a criminal suspect doesn't appear to be a U.S. citizen. A Superior Court judge dismissed the suit last year, saying the California law on which it was based was an invalid attempt by the state to regulate immigration. The First District Court of Appeal disagreed Wednesday and said the law, though it might affect immigration, is based on the state's legal authority to combat drug trafficking," the San Francisco Chronicle reports.
